UR - https://www1.montpellier.inrae.fr/CBGP/acarologia/article.php?id=2946 DA - 1979-03-31 KW - Parapyroppia KW - new genus KW - Spain AB - Parapyroppia, a new genus belonging in the family Metrioppiidae is described. Its chief characters are: monodactyle tarsi, striated lamellae and spindle-shaped sensilli. The distal end of each sensillus wears a setaceous prolongation as in the species of Liacarus. P. monodactyla, type of the genus, is described. It looks like a Pyroppia but it is easily distinguished by many characters. This species lives in the litter at the Sierra de Cazorla (Province of Jaen, Spain) . Some comments are made on the family Metrioppiidae. ER -
